More about mental health courses in Madeley
If you're looking to embark on a fulfilling career in the mental health sector, Madeley offers a range of comprehensive training options designed for both beginners and experienced professionals. With 18 available Mental Health courses, you can find the right fit to enhance your skills and knowledge. Whether you are considering the Certificate III in Community Services for those starting out or more advanced qualifications like the Certificate IV in Mental Health and the Diploma of Mental Health, courses in this vibrant suburb of Perth, WA, are accessible and tailored to meet industry standards.
Within the local area, several reputable training providers are committed to delivering high-quality education in mental health. For instance, LearnEd Training offers the Certificate IV in Mental Health, while IHNA provides the Diploma of Mental Health. Additionally, South Metropolitan TAFE offers the Certificate III in Community Services, ensuring that students receive practical skills and knowledge in a face-to-face learning environment.
Exploring specific study areas within the Mental Health field can greatly enhance your career prospects. Courses in Counselling, Social Work, and Disability are just a few options available in Madeley. Enrolling in courses such as the Diploma of Community Services (Case Management) is an excellent choice for those seeking to specialise in case management roles, which are in high demand across Australia.
The mental health industry is vast, with various job roles ranging from mental health support workers to qualified social workers. With qualifications such as the Master of Social Work, you can advance into higher-level positions offering critical services to individuals and communities. Explore programmes like the Graduate Diploma in Counselling or consider a Bachelor of Community Services to develop a well-rounded understanding of the field.
Mental health awareness is increasingly important in our society, and the demand for qualified professionals continues to grow. By choosing to study in Madeley, you are not only investing in your education but also contributing to the well-being of your community. With a variety of courses available and multiple training providers such as Murdoch University and Stanley College, you can conveniently access the training necessary for a successful career in this vital sector.
